Dr. Kate Hood, BKin, DC

5.0 (6 Ratings)
Dr. Kate Hood graduated from Palmer West College of Chiropractic in San Jose, California, with awards in Leadership, Sport, and Clinical Excellence. With years of experience, Dr. Hood has worked with athletes from various disciplines, including volleyball, triathlon, track and field, and swimming.

Active Release Therapy
ART provides a way to diagnose and treat the underlying causes of cumulative trauma disorders that result in symptoms of numbness, tingling, burning and aching. ART is a type of manual hands-on therapy that corrects muscular and soft tissue problems caused by adhesion formation as a result of injury, overuse or cumulative trauma.

Dry Needling & Medical Acupuncture
Medical acupuncture is an effective treatment approach aimed at reducing pain, improving function and increasing muscle activation. During this treatment, a thin, single use needle is carefully guided into the skin and specific tissues. The needle stimulates the release of the body’s own painkillers, such as endorphins.
